SJCQC MARKS PERFORMANCE MILESTONES!
St. Joseph’s College of Quezon City celebrates recent student achievements as the SJC Band placed 2nd in the Battle of the Bands, while the RHYTHMYX Dance Troupe secured Rank 4 in the Move It, Groove It for a Cause ’25 P-pop dance competition.
These milestones reflect the talent, dedication, and excellence of Josephine performers.

We proudly congratulate our Taekwondo Club members who successfully passed the Promotion Test conducted by the Philippine Taekwondo Association last November 30, 2025.
From White Belt to Yellow Belt, their achievement reflects discipline, perseverance, respect, and hard work—values that truly define a Josephine.
The celebration was made more meaningful with a wood-breaking demonstration and belt-changing ceremony, marking an important milestone in their Taekwondo journey.
